Where is the cheapest but nicest place to live in the US?

Coming in at the top of the C2ER list was Cedar Park, Texas, which was named the most affordable place to live in America. Set outside Austin, Cedar Park made it to the top of the list, due to its low cost of living index (7.2% below the national average) and high income levels (17.8% above the national median).

What is the best state to live in financially?

Alaska is the top state for fiscal stability. It’s followed by South Dakota, Tennessee, Idaho and Utah to round out the top five. Half of the 10 states with the best fiscal stability also rank among the top 10 Best States overall.

What state is the happiest?

According to a study by Amerisleep, the happiest state is North Dakota (#1) followed by Vermont, Nebraska, South Dakota and California. The least happy states were Kentucky (#50) followed by West Virginia, Tennessee, Nevada and Ohio (see complete list below).
